1 pound ground coffee; 2 tablespoons almond extract; 2 tablespoons vanilla extract; image/svg+xml Text Ingredients Directions Place coffee in a large jar with tight-fitting lid. Add extracts. Cover and shake well. Store in an airtight container in a cool, dark and dry place or in the freezer. Prepare coffee as usual.

Almond extract is the main flavoring ingredient in Italian biscotti and can be used in cheesecakes, cookies, and other desserts. Almond extract can be added to stewed fruit, coffee, and the batter for French toast. In China, almond essence is essential for the popular almond jelly snack. Spicy food fan? Almond Extract. Almond extract is another popular extract that can be used in coffee. It has a nutty, slightly sweet flavor that pairs well with coffee. Almond extract is made by soaking almonds in alcohol, which extracts the flavor compounds from the nuts. When using almond extract in coffee, it's important to use a high-quality extract.

In This Article. Almond extract is a concentrated liquid made from bitter almond oil, alcohol, and water. It's typically used in baking, much like vanilla extract, and a little goes a long way because the flavor is so strong. In fact, many people who like the mildly nutty taste of almonds say they dislike the taste of almond extract.
